In Australia, a full time Beekeeper generally earns $1,400 per week ($72,800 annual salary) before tax. This is a median figure for full-time employees and should be considered a guide only. As you gain more experience you can expect a potentially higher salary than people who are new to the industry.

The number of people working in this industry has increased in recent years. There are now 1,200 people working as a Beekeeper in Australia compared to 1,000 five years ago. Beekeepers may find work across all regions of Australia but are more likely to find job opportunities in rural and regional areas.

Source: Australian Government Labour Market Insights

A Certificate III in Beekeeping is an ideal qualification if you’re planning a career as a Beekeeper. This course will explore topics such as establishing an apiary site, assembling and maintaining a beehive and managing a honey bee swarm. You’ll learn how to extract honey, use smokers and transport a beehive.

Whether you are starting your journey into beekeeping or looking to expand your skills, there are several beginner courses available in Albany, 6330 Australia. You can choose from the Certificate III in Beekeeping AHC31818, which provides a solid foundation, or the Manage Pests and Disease within a Honey Bee Colony AHCBEK313 course, geared towards managing bee health effectively. Additionally, the Basic Beekeeping Skill Set AHCSS00075 is perfect for those new to the field.

These courses are delivered by esteemed training providers such as the WA College of Agriculture - Denmark.
